Background
⌘K

How to Exclude Products or Plans from Commissions

Use a $0 fixed-amount incentive to exclude specific products, monthly plans, yearly plans, or one-time purchases from affiliate commissions

Silvestro
Written by Silvestro
Last updated on April 28, 2026

Sometimes you need to keep specific products out of your affiliate program — a lifetime deal, an internal add-on, a discounted promo plan, or any SKU where paying commission doesn't make sense. You don't have to remove the default reward for the whole group: you can layer a $0 incentive on top of it that targets only the products you want to exclude.

How It Works

Affonso resolves commissions in a clear priority order. A more specific applyTo always wins over a more generic one:

  1. SPECIFIC_PRODUCTS — match exact product or price IDs
  2. YEARLY_PLANS — match yearly subscriptions
  3. MONTHLY_PLANS — match monthly subscriptions
  4. ONE_TIME_PRODUCTS — match one-time purchases
  5. ALL_PLANS — the group default

A $0 incentive at a higher specificity overrides the default group reward for matching sales, leaving everything else untouched.

Step-by-Step: Exclude a Specific Product

  1. Go to your Groups & Rewards settings
  2. Open the affiliate group whose default reward you want to override
  3. Click "Add Incentive"
  4. Choose Fixed Amount as the commission type
  5. Set the Amount to 0
  6. Choose "Specific products" as the trigger
  7. Select or create the product(s) you want to exclude (matching the price or product IDs from your payment processor)
  8. Configure the rest of the incentive (length, approval) as usual
  9. Save

That's it. Sales of the selected products will resolve to a $0 commission while every other product in the group keeps earning the default reward.

Note: Only Fixed Amount rewards can be set to 0. Percentage, Credits, and Free Months rewards must always be greater than 0. To exclude a product, choose Fixed Amount and enter 0.

Excluding Entire Plan Types

The same workflow applies for broader exclusions. Pick the matching applyTo:

  • Exclude all yearly plans → Fixed Amount 0, applyTo Yearly plans
  • Exclude all monthly plans → Fixed Amount 0, applyTo Monthly plans
  • Exclude one-time purchases → Fixed Amount 0, applyTo One-time products

Because these are more specific than ALL_PLANS, they override the group default for that segment of sales.

Excluding for a Single Affiliate

If you want to exclude products only for one affiliate (and not the whole group), create an AffiliateIncentiveOverride with the same $0 setup. Per-affiliate overrides take precedence over group incentives, so the rest of the group keeps the original commission.

What You'll See in the Dashboard

Excluded sales still flow through tracking, so you'll see a referral and an earning record for each one — just with a $0 commission. This keeps your reporting accurate and lets you confirm the exclusion is working without silencing the sale entirely.


Need to exclude a product right now? Open your Groups & Rewards settings and add a $0 fixed-amount incentive on the product you want to skip.

Was this article helpful?

If you still need help, our support team is here for you.

Contact Support
bg

Ready to Scale Your SaaS?

Affonso is the easiest way to launch your own affiliate program. We take care of the technical stuff, so you can focus on growing your business.